About the program:
Sugarbelle Foundation is a registered 501-c3, whose mission is to keep pets and people together. We accomplish this by providing financial assistance, to the best of our ability, to pet owners and Good Samaritans who have an animal in need, temporary fosters homes, food, and any other necessary items for pets and their people.
All donated shoes are redistributed throughout the Funds2Orgs network of microenterprise partners in developing nations. Funds2Orgs helps impoverished people start, maintain and grow businesses in countries such as Haiti, Honduras and other nations in Central America and Africa. Proceeds from the shoe sales are in turn to feed, clothe and house their families. Funds2Org believes the HAND UP is more beneficial than the HAND OUT because it teaches people how to be self-sufficient which is also what Sugarbelle Foundation strives to do when helping pets and their families.

Reminder: Please check grades in INOW!
Hi Parents! We are a little over the half-way mark in the 1st nine weeks! We have had a great start to the school year. Remember there are still 3 weeks left in this grading period, so there is plenty of time to bring up any grades your child is not satisfied with and maintain the ones they do like! This is a good learning experience to help them identify the areas they need to improve.
Please remember that grades are updated daily/weekly. Please check student grades in INOW.
If you do not have an INOW login, you can contact Jennifer Cole in the office to get your information, or you can log in with your child's information. If you have concerns about your child's average in a subject, please click the "A" activity button to see a breakdown of assignments. As stated at parent night, your child is the first point of contact. If you see a "zero" then it is an assignment they did not turn in. If there is a "0.01" then it is something they can make up due to being absent. If there is a "blank" then this is a grade they might be unable to make up and it is not included in their average and therefore does not hurt their grade.
